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Bag compatibility: Check if the holder supports Foley, nephrostomy, or leg bags and the typical bag volume you use.
- Attachment method: Quick-release buckles, zippers, hooks, and straps affect ease of use and security. Choose based on how you move and where you’ll place the bag.
- Privacy and discreet design: If social or caregiver interactions matter, prioritize covers with hidden bags and tubing, plus low-profile colors.
- Material and care: Vinyl and canvas offer durability; water-resistant or machine-washable surfaces simplify cleaning, especially for daily use.
- Size and fit: Ensure dimensions align with your bags and furniture (wheelchairs, beds, chairs). Adjustable straps improve compatibility across setups.
- Maintenance considerations: Some products allow machine washing; others require hand washing to preserve materials and seams.
Frequently Asked Questions
- What is the main purpose of a urinary drainage bag holder?
It secures and discreetly conceals urine bags, reducing exposure and preventing bag movement during use. - Who benefits most from these holders?
Wheelchair users, bed-bound patients, and caregivers who need a reliable, discreet mounting solution. - Are these holders reusable and easy to clean?
Most options are washable or wipe-clean; materials vary between vinyl, canvas, and fabric-based designs. - How do I choose between vinyl and canvas?
Vinyl tends to be more water-resistant and easy to wipe; canvas offers durability and a softer feel but may require careful care for stains. - Can these holders accommodate large drainage bags?
Some models support up to 2000ml or larger bags; verify bag capacity in product details before purchasing. - Is a freestanding stand more convenient than a wrap-around cover?
Freestanding stands are great for night use; wrap-around covers are typically lighter and easier to move during the day.
